The 3-star London Backpackers Youth Hostel 18 - 35 Years Old Only, located at a distance of 3.2 km from Neasden, features Wi-Fi in the rooms.
Location
Nearby shopping destinations comprise Brent Cross Shopping Centre (1.4 km) and London Designer Outlet (4.5 km) for visitors to explore. This hostel is situated at a distance of 4.4 km from Kenwood House and in close proximity to the civic Hendon Park.
The hostel is just a 5-minute walk from Hendon Way bus stop and just a 5-minute walk from Hendon Central underground station.
Rooms
Some rooms at the property include a shared bathroom with a shower, and also feature a work desk. London Backpackers Youth Hostel 18 - 35 Years Old Only is also complemented by parquetry floor, soundproof windows.
Eat & Drink
This accommodation is within walking distance of Jade Cottage SiuSiu BBQ Restaurant, offering dishes of Asian cuisine. There is a shared kitchen provided on site.
